    My biometric residence permit (BRP)  expires on 31 Dec 2024 - when and how do I renew it?

    The reason your biometric residence permit [BRP] (and in fact all BRPs) expires on 31 Dec 2024 is that the Government is moving to an all-digital system. Even though your card expires then, it does not necessarily mean your status or rights expire. The Government is planning to contact people in 2024 regarding moving to a digital status.

    You should have received a letter from the Home Office confirming when your leave expires and advising that your BRP may expire earlier.  If you do not already have access to your immigration status information online then you may rely on this letter as confirmation of the actual expiry date of your leave.

    In due course, you will be given online access to your immigration status information via the view and prove service.  You will then be able to use this service to see the correct expiry date of your leave.

    It is also worth keeping in mind that as a BRP holder, if you need to demonstrate your right to work to an employer or your right to rent to a landlord then you can already access the online right to work and right to rent services.  These contain real-time status information which reflect the duration of your leave, rather than the expiry date stated on your BRP card.
